Patent number: 8492483Abstract: To provide a novel ABA-type triblock copolymer of vinyl ether series, comprising polyvinyl ether and an oxystyrene-series unit, and a process of producing the ABA-type copolymer at a series of steps. The invention relates to a novel ABA-type triblock copolymer comprising Segment A comprising an oxystyrene-series repeat unit (a) and Segment B comprising a vinyl ether-series repeat unit (b), in which the Segment A and the Segment B are bonded together with a single bond, and to a simple process of producing the same. The triblock copolymer can be produced at a series of steps in a simple manner, comprising living cationic polymerization of a vinyl ether-series monomer such as ethyl vinyl ether in the presence of a bifunctional initiator and a Lewis acid, and subsequently adding an oxystyrene-series monomer such as p-hydroxystyrene for living cationic polymerization.Type: GrantFiled: June 19, 2008Date of Patent: July 23, 2013Assignee: Maruzen Petrochemical Co., Ltd.Inventors: Norihiro Yoshida, Hijiri Aoki, Takahito Mita, Ami Yamaguchi, Kazuhiko Haba, Goro Sawada

Patent number: 7858710Abstract: A method of preparing periodic, semi-periodic, or semi-random polyethylene-co-acrylic acid or polyethylene-co-methacrylic acid involves polymerizing 1-alkoxyalkyl ester substituted ?,?-dienes, and/or 1-alkoxyalkyl ester substituted cycloalkenes via olefin metathesis reactions followed by hydrogenation of the alkylene units and subsequently hydrolyzed to the desired polyethylene-co-acrylic acid or polyethylene-co-methacrylic acid. The polyethylene-co-acrylic acid or polyethylene-co-methacrylic acid can then be converted to ionomers by exchange with a monomeric carboxylate salt.Type: GrantFiled: April 23, 2007Date of Patent: December 28, 2010Assignee: University of Florida Research Foundation, Inc.Inventors: Kenneth Boone Wagener, Travis W.
